ACI Speaks Up for Oleochemicals

Author Image

By: TOM BRANNA

Editor

The US oleochemical industry will continue to be hard hit by the Environmental Protection Agency’s policymaking on the Renewable Fuel Standard (RFS2), according to the American Cleaning Institute (ACI), which represents the producers of oleochemicals. “ACI regrets that, once again, the EPA has dismissed the concerns of the domestic oleochemical industry relating to the Renewable Fuel Standard’s impact on the price and availability of animal fats,” said Ernie Rosenberg, ACI president and CEO, in...
